Learning outcomes

The student will have knowledge on the habitability conditions of the Early Earth, on the Archean geobiology, especially on to the Paleoarchean, and of the related fossil record. The student will have a critical vision of how and when Earth become house for life, where life first appeared on Earth, how it evolved, how and where it was preserved in the fossil record and how to recognize it. Furthermore, the student will be introduced to the concept of biosignature and to the most advanced techniques for life detection, and to the biogenicity problem. The student will learn to prepare samples for optical, SEM-EDX, Raman and CLSM microscopies.

Course contents

Archean paleoenviroments and fossil record. Biogenicity problem. Analitycal technics applied to the early fossil record.
